Factors Affecting Cost
- Material Choice: The type of material you choose (concrete, pavers, natural stone) can significantly impact the overall cost.
- Patio Size: Larger patios require more materials and labor, thus increasing the total expense.
- Design Complexity: Intricate designs with custom features will generally cost more due to increased labor and material needs.
- Site Preparation: The condition of the installation site, including grading and excavation, can add to the costs.
- Permits and Regulations: Local building codes and permits may incur additional fees.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Newport Beach can vary, affecting the total installation c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ost |
---|---|
Basic Concrete Patio | $8 - $12 per sq. ft. |
Paver Patio Installation | $15 - $25 per sq. ft. |
Natural Stone Patio | $20 - $35 per sq. ft. |
Site Preparation and Grading | $500 - $1,500 |
Permit Fees | $100 - $300 |
Custom Design Features | $1,000 - $5,000 |
